    Hace 2 días · Eton College (/ ˈ iː t ən /) is a public school (fee-charging and boarding for secondary school age boys) in Eton, Berkshire, England.It was founded in 1440 by Henry VI under the name Kynge's College of Our Ladye of Eton besyde Windesore, making it the 18th-oldest school in the Headmasters' and Headmistresses' Conference (HMC).

  7. Hace 5 días · Harrow on the Hill is home to the famous Harrow School, founded in 1572 and attended by Winston Churchill. There is also a large shopping area in the town centre. North Harrow is home to Harrow Heritage Centre museum and the 14th century Headstone Manor.
